Webb26 juli 2024 · Nathan Gerbe comes in as the shortest player in the current NHL and only one inch from tying Worters as the shortest player in league history. The 5-foot-4 left winger has been in the league since 2008 and has played for three organizations: the Buffalo Sabres, Carolina Hurricanes and now the Columbus Blue Jackets.
